Pastel

A Matrix bot that posts gaming deals and free game alerts to a specified Matrix room.

Deals are sourced from PC/digital storefronts only (Steam, GOG, Humble Store, GreenManGaming, Epic Games Store) — universally accessible regardless of region.

Data Sources

  • CheapShark — polled every 2 hours for top deals across Steam, GOG, Humble Store, and GreenManGaming
  • IsThereAnyDeal — polled every 2 hours for deals across all tracked stores, with built-in historical low detection (requires API key)
  • Epic Games Store — polled daily for free game promotions

CheapShark and IsThereAnyDeal can be used individually or together — configure via the DEAL_SOURCES variable. When used as a deal source, IsThereAnyDeal provides historical low flags directly. When only CheapShark is active, IsThereAnyDeal can still optionally enrich deals with historical low info via the ITAD_API_KEY.

Quick Start

  1. Copy .env.example to .env and fill in your Matrix credentials and room ID
  2. Run with Docker:
docker build -t pastel .
docker run --env-file .env -v pastel-data:/data pastel

Or run directly with Python 3.12+:

pip install -r requirements.txt
python -m gaming_deals_bot

Obtaining a Matrix Bot Access Token

  1. Create a bot account on your homeserver (e.g. via Element: register a new account like @dealsbot:example.com).

  2. Log in and get the access token using curl:

    curl -XPOST "https://matrix.example.com/_matrix/client/v3/login" \
      -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
      -d '{
        "type": "m.login.password",
        "identifier": { "type": "m.id.user", "user": "dealsbot" },
        "password": "YOUR_PASSWORD"
      }'
    

    The response will contain an access_token field — copy that value into your .env as MATRIX_BOT_ACCESS_TOKEN.

  3. Invite the bot to your deals room, then have the bot accept the invite (the bot does this automatically on startup).

Tip: After extracting the token you can change the bot account's password without invalidating the token. Store the token securely — anyone with it can act as the bot.

Configuration

All configuration is via environment variables (see .env.example):

Core

Variable Required Default Description
MATRIX_HOMESERVER_URL Yes Matrix homeserver URL
MATRIX_BOT_USER_ID Yes Bot's Matrix user ID
MATRIX_BOT_ACCESS_TOKEN Yes Bot's access token
MATRIX_DEALS_ROOM_ID Yes Room ID to post deals in
ITAD_API_KEY No IsThereAnyDeal API key (required when itad is in DEAL_SOURCES, optional otherwise for historical low detection)
DEAL_SOURCES No cheapshark Comma-separated deal sources: cheapshark, itad, or cheapshark,itad
ITAD_COUNTRIES No US Comma-separated ISO 3166-1 alpha-2 country codes to fetch ITAD deals from (e.g. US,CA,GB,DE)
DEFAULT_CURRENCY No USD Primary display currency shown first in price strings
EXTRA_CURRENCIES No CAD,EUR,GBP Additional currencies shown after the default (comma-separated)
SEND_INTRO_MESSAGE No false Send "The deals must flow." to the room on startup
DATABASE_PATH No deals.db Path to SQLite database file

Filtering

Each deal source has its own filter settings. Source-specific values take priority; when not set they fall back to the shared defaults.

Variable Source Default Description
CHEAPSHARK_MIN_DISCOUNT CheapShark 50 Minimum discount percentage
CHEAPSHARK_MIN_RATING CheapShark 8.0 Minimum deal rating (0-10, 0 = unrated allowed)
CHEAPSHARK_MAX_PRICE CheapShark 20 Maximum sale price (USD)
ITAD_MIN_DISCOUNT ITAD 50 Minimum discount percentage
ITAD_MAX_PRICE ITAD 20 Maximum sale price (USD, prices from other regions are converted)
ITAD_DEALS_LIMIT ITAD 200 Number of deals to fetch per country (max 200)
MIN_DISCOUNT_PERCENT Shared 50 Fallback minimum discount when source-specific value is not set
MAX_PRICE Shared 20 Fallback maximum price when source-specific value is not set

Preflight Check

Run --check to validate your configuration and test connectivity to all services before starting the bot:

python -m gaming_deals_bot --check

This verifies:

  • Matrix — authentication token is valid and bot has joined the target room
  • CheapShark — API is reachable (skipped if not in DEAL_SOURCES)
  • Epic Games Store — API is reachable
  • Frankfurter — exchange rate API is reachable
  • IsThereAnyDeal — API key is valid (required when itad is in DEAL_SOURCES, skipped otherwise if not configured)

The command exits with code 0 on success and 1 on failure, so it works in CI and Docker health-checks.

Behavior

  • First run: fetches current deals and records them in the database without posting (avoids spamming the room with existing deals)
  • Deduplication: deals are tracked by game ID + timestamp; duplicates are never reposted
  • Pruning: deals older than 30 days are pruned from the database so they can be reposted if they return
  • One message per deal: each deal is posted individually so messages are independently linkable and dismissible
  • Multi-currency pricing: deal prices are shown in your configured currencies (default: USD, CAD, EUR, GBP) using live exchange rates from the Frankfurter API (ECB data, no API key required). Set DEFAULT_CURRENCY to change the primary display currency and EXTRA_CURRENCIES for additional ones. Rates are cached and refreshed twice daily.
  • Multi-country ITAD deals: when using IsThereAnyDeal, deals can be fetched from multiple countries simultaneously via ITAD_COUNTRIES (e.g. US,CA,GB,DE). Deals are merged and deduplicated, with the first country in the list taking priority for duplicate games.
